View Issue Details

IDProjectCategoryView StatusLast Update
0000439OpenIVPackage Installerpublic2017-02-13 16:22
ReporterStryfaarAssigned To 
PriorityimmediateSeveritycrashReproducibilityalways
Status closedResolutionno change required 
PlatformWindowsOS10 (64-bit)OS Version10.0
Product Version2.8 
Target VersionFixed in Version 
Summary0000439: Crashing, but I can't find anything wrong in my OIV package?
DescriptionI was this close into uploading my mod when the OIV I made failed me lol. It just keeps crashing, and if this helps, here's the log:

Time: "14:01:49"
Type: "EAccessViolation"
Message: "Access violation at address 00E267A8 in module 'OpenIV.exe'. Read of address 00000004"

Additional information:
[Application Context]
GetThreadLocale=1033 (0x0409)
App::PackageInstaller::File=D:\GAMES\IMMERSIVE PICKUPS\OIV Packages\Immersive Pickups\Immersive Pickups 1.0.oiv
Game::Path=D:\STEAM\steamapps\common\Grand Theft Auto V\
WebClientId=3176266
GetSystemDefaultLangID=1033
App::Lang=en_GB
App::Path=C:\Users\Stryfaar\AppData\Local\New Technology Studio\Apps\OpenIV\
Main::ExploreArchiveNode::WorkItem=D:\STEAM\steamapps\common\Grand Theft Auto V\
Main::ExploreArchiveNode::ParentArchive=D:\STEAM\steamapps\common\Grand Theft Auto V\
App::Temp=C:\Users\Stryfaar\AppData\Local\Temp\OpenIV_02557F88\
ApplicationPath=C:\Users\Stryfaar\AppData\Local\New Technology Studio\Apps\OpenIV\
OS=Windows (Version 10.0, Build 14393, 64-bit Edition)
GetSystemDefaultLCID=1033
Game::ID=Five (GTA V)
Game::Platform=pc
SysLocale={ DefaultLCID: "1033", PriLangID: "9", SubLangID: "1", FarEast: "True", MiddleEast: "True" }

[Application Windows]
TPackageInstallerWindow2=Immersive Pickups - Package installer
TActionsModule=ActionsModule
TMainWindow=OpenIV - GTA V - [Read only mode]
TErrorWindow=OpenIV - Application error

  Release: 2.8.0.703 5/22/2016
  Address: "0x00E267A8"
  Procedure: "Rage2.Archives.RPF7.CRageRPF7ArchiveBase.CreateTableStream"
  Unit: "Rage2.Archives.RPF7.pas", Line: "559"

Stack:
[00E267A8] Rage2.Archives.RPF7.CRageRPF7ArchiveBase.CreateTableStream (Line 559, "Rage2.Archives.RPF7.pas" + 15) + $E
[77DE2D70] Unknown function at RtlConvertUlongToLargeInteger + $A0
[77DE2D3F] Unknown function at RtlConvertUlongToLargeInteger + $6F
[77DBF28A] Unknown function at RtlUnwind + $28A
[77DD08EA] KiUserExceptionDispatcher + $A
[00E267A3] Rage2.Archives.RPF7.CRageRPF7ArchiveBase.CreateTableStream (Line 559, "Rage2.Archives.RPF7.pas" + 15) + $9
[74F110A4] WideCharToMultiByte + $264
[004067C0] System.@FreeMem + $4
[0040C1AD] System.@DynArrayClear + $35
[004B73FB] System.Classes.TStream.WriteBuffer + $AB
[00444C26] System.Generics.Defaults.Equals_UString + $A
[00E1C3B5] Rage2.Archives.RPF2.{System.Generics.Collections}TDictionary<System.string,System.Int64>.GetBucketIndex (Line 56, "System.Generics.Defaults.pas" + 0) + $62
[00E26A8C] Rage2.Archives.RPF7.CRageRPF7ArchiveBase.CreateTableItem (Line 610, "Rage2.Archives.RPF7.pas" + 10) + $1A
[00E267A3] Rage2.Archives.RPF7.CRageRPF7ArchiveBase.CreateTableStream (Line 559, "Rage2.Archives.RPF7.pas" + 15) + $9
[00E27A13] Rage2.Archives.RPF7.CRageRPF7ArchiveNG.WriteTable (Line 1128, "Rage2.Archives.RPF7.pas" + 2) + $E
[007B84B5] Rage2.Archives.CFileBasedArchive.WriteTableAndHeader (Line 1404, "Rage2.Archives.pas" + 1) + $F
[00E14AD3] Rage2.Archives.RPFBase.CRageRPFArchiveEditableBase.WriteTableAndHeader (Line 635, "Rage2.Archives.RPFBase.pas" + 2) + $4
[00E16AFA] Rage2.Archives.RPFBase.CRageRPFArchiveEditableBase.DoAddFileData (Line 1357, "Rage2.Archives.RPFBase.pas" + 10) + $6
[007B70A1] Rage2.Archives.CRageArchive.AddFile (Line 1148, "Rage2.Archives.pas" + 11) + $E
[00943033] Tools.PackageInstaller.Classes.TPackageInstaller20.ProcessArchiveAddCommand (Line 1152, "Tools.PackageInstaller.Classes.pas" + 38) + $19
[00942C3C] Tools.PackageInstaller.Classes.TPackageInstaller20.ProcessArchive (Line 1096, "Tools.PackageInstaller.Classes.pas" + 9) + $12
[0094382E] Tools.PackageInstaller.Classes.TPackageInstaller20.ProcessArchiveArchiveCommand (Line 1233, "Tools.PackageInstaller.Classes.pas" + 28) + $11
[00942C3C] Tools.PackageInstaller.Classes.TPackageInstaller20.ProcessArchive (Line 1096, "Tools.PackageInstaller.Classes.pas" + 9) + $12
[00942665] Tools.PackageInstaller.Classes.TPackageInstaller20.Install (Line 1023, "Tools.PackageInstaller.Classes.pas" + 5) + $36
[014F5A01] Tools.PackageInstaller.Window2.UIPackageInstallerWindow2.InstallPackage (Line 1729, "Tools.PackageInstaller.Window2.pas" + 10) + $7
[014F571D] Tools.PackageInstaller.Window2.UIPackageInstallerWindow2.ShowInstallProgressUI$22833$ActRec.$0$Body$22834$ActRec.$0$0$Body (Line 1711, "Tools.PackageInstaller.Window2.pas" + 2) + $D
[004C4BFD] System.Classes.TAnonymousThread.Execute + $5
[004C4F6E] System.Classes.ThreadProc + $42
[0040970C] System.ThreadWrapper + $28
[74CD62C2] BaseThreadInitThunk + $22
[77DC0FD7] Unknown function at RtlSubscribeWnfStateChangeNotification + $437
[77DC0F9F] Unknown function at RtlSubscribeWnfStateChangeNotification + $3FF
ClientId: 3176266, ReportId: 1576324

Any help would be appreciated. I really want to upload the mod within the hour or so. Please assist.
Additional InformationThe following section contains the additional details that were recorded.

These details help accurately identify the programs and UI you used in this recording.

This section may contain text that is internal to programs that only very advanced users or programmers may understand.

Please review these details to ensure that they do not contain any information that you would not like others to see.



Recording Session: ‎2/‎12/‎2017 2:09:11 PM - 2:09:25 PM

Recorded Steps: 3, Missed Steps: 0, Other Errors: 0

Operating System: 14393.693.amd64fre.rs1_release.161220-1747 10.0.0.0.2.48

Step 1: User left click on "[ERROR] Direct3D is not initialized. (pane)" in "Immersive Pickups - Package installer"
Program: OpenIV, 2.8.0.703, New Technology Studio, OPENIV.EXE D:\GAMES\IMMERSIVE PICKUPS\OIV PACKAGES\IMMERSIVE PICKUPS\IMMERSIVE PICKUPS 1.0.OIV, OPENIV.EXE
UI Elements: [ERROR] Direct3D is not initialized., TPanel, Immersive Pickups - Package installer, TPackageInstallerWindow2

Step 2: User left click on "[ERROR] Direct3D is not initialized. (pane)" in "Immersive Pickups - Package installer"
Program: OpenIV, 2.8.0.703, New Technology Studio, OPENIV.EXE D:\GAMES\IMMERSIVE PICKUPS\OIV PACKAGES\IMMERSIVE PICKUPS\IMMERSIVE PICKUPS 1.0.OIV, OPENIV.EXE
UI Elements: [ERROR] Direct3D is not initialized., TPanel, Immersive Pickups - Package installer, TPackageInstallerWindow2

Step 3: User left click on "Close OpenIV (button)" in "OpenIV - Application error"
Program: OpenIV, 2.8.0.703, New Technology Studio, OPENIV.EXE D:\GAMES\IMMERSIVE PICKUPS\OIV PACKAGES\IMMERSIVE PICKUPS\IMMERSIVE PICKUPS 1.0.OIV, OPENIV.EXE
UI Elements: Close OpenIV, TButton, OpenIV - Application error, TErrorWindow
TagsNo tags attached.
GameGrand Theft Auto V

Activities

Stryfaar

2017-02-12 15:04

reporter  

assembly.xml (7,132 bytes)

GooD-NTS

2017-02-13 10:12

administrator   ~0000190

You have errors in your code.

For example here:
<add source="...">x64\levels\gta5\props\lev_des_mp_dlc.rpf\hei_prop_cash_crate_half_full.ydr</add>

You can't use that target path, please check here how to work with inner archives:
http://docs.openiv.com/doku.php?id=packages:version_21#archive_commands

Stryfaar

2017-02-13 16:10

reporter   ~0000191

Thanks man, fixed it!

Issue History

Date Modified Username Field Change
2017-02-12 15:04 Stryfaar New Issue
2017-02-12 15:04 Stryfaar File Added: assembly.xml
2017-02-13 10:12 GooD-NTS Note Added: 0000190
2017-02-13 10:12 GooD-NTS Assigned To => GooD-NTS
2017-02-13 10:12 GooD-NTS Status new => feedback
2017-02-13 16:10 Stryfaar Note Added: 0000191
2017-02-13 16:10 Stryfaar Status feedback => assigned
2017-02-13 16:22 GooD-NTS Status assigned => closed
2017-02-13 16:22 GooD-NTS Assigned To GooD-NTS =>
2017-02-13 16:22 GooD-NTS Resolution open => no change required